Thank you Steffen, it worked. I am stupid, but now Google knows how to fix ipmitool hang. :-)
rmmod ipmi_devintf ipmi_si ipmi_msghandler lsmod|grep ipmi modprobe ipmi_devintf ipmi_si ipmi_msghandler -----Original Message----- From: Steffen Grunewald [mailto:steffen.grunew...@aei.mpg.de] Sent: Friday, April 17, 2015 4:30 PM To: Vladimir Vul Cc: ipmitool-devel@lists.sourceforge.net Subject: Re: [Ipmitool-devel] ipmitool hangs reading /dev/ipmi0 on Centos 7 On Fri, Apr 17, 2015 at 01:07:31PM +0000, Vladimir Vul wrote: > Hello! > "Ipmitool lan print" and any other command hangs forever trying to > read something from /dev/ipmi0 (see strace.log attached) > > ipmitool version 1.8.13 (and 1.8.11 do the same) > > [root@sasa ~]# lsmod|grep ipmi > ipmi_devintf 17572 0 > ipmi_si 53257 0 > ipmi_msghandler 45306 2 ipmi_devintf,ipmi_si > > > root@sasa ~]# ls -l "/dev/ipmi0" > crw------- 1 root root 245, 0 Apr 17 13:32 /dev/ipmi0 > > [root@sasa ~]# uname -a > Linux sasa 3.10.0-123.20.1.el7.x86_64 #1 SMP Thu Jan 29 18:05:33 UTC > 2015 x86_64 x86_64 x86_64 GNU/Linux > > [root@sasa ~]# cat /etc/redhat-release CentOS Linux release 7.1.1503 > (Core) > > Long logs are attached > > BMC console is working and I can login by HTTP.
